public class DbRequestSingle extends Object
| Constructor and Description |
|---|
DbRequestSingle(VitamCollection collection)
Constructor with VitamCollection
|
| Modifier and Type | Method and Description |
|---|---|
static boolean |
checkInsertOrUpdate(Exception e)
Helper to detect an insert that should be an Update
|
DbRequestResult |
execute(RequestSingle request)
execute all request
|
DbRequestResult |
execute(RequestSingle request,
Integer version)
execute all request
|
public DbRequestSingle(VitamCollection collection)
collection - public DbRequestResult execute(RequestSingle request) throws InvalidParseOperationException, BadRequestException, DatabaseException, InvalidCreateOperationException, VitamDBException, SchemaValidationException
request - InvalidParseOperationExceptionDatabaseExceptionBadRequestExceptionInvalidCreateOperationExceptionSecurityExceptionNoSuchMethodExceptionInvocationTargetExceptionIllegalArgumentExceptionIllegalAccessExceptionInstantiationExceptionVitamDBExceptionSchemaValidationExceptionpublic DbRequestResult execute(RequestSingle request, Integer version) throws InvalidParseOperationException, DatabaseException, BadRequestException, InvalidCreateOperationException, VitamDBException, SchemaValidationException
request - version - InvalidParseOperationExceptionDatabaseExceptionBadRequestExceptionInvalidCreateOperationExceptionSecurityExceptionNoSuchMethodExceptionInvocationTargetExceptionIllegalArgumentExceptionIllegalAccessExceptionInstantiationExceptionVitamDBExceptionSchemaValidationExceptionpublic static boolean checkInsertOrUpdate(Exception e)
e - exception catchedCopyright © 2018 Vitam. All rights reserved.